Bird's Nest Fern

Asplenium nidus

Asplenium Nidus (Bird's Nest Fern) is a proud Australian native fern found in temperate and tropical rainforests of eastern Queensland and New South Wales. Naturally growing as an epiphyte on tree branches, it forms a large, vase-like rosette of glossy, apple-green, strap-like fronds with wavy margins and a dark, prominent central rib, mimicking a bird's nest.

Native Origin & Climate

Humid, shaded rainforest canopies of coastal Queensland and eastern New South Wales. Enjoys warm coastal Australian conditions.

Expert Pruning Tip

Cut away old, brown fronds near the base of the crown. Never prune the central growing crown (the nest), as it is highly sensitive to damage.

Care Profile

Beginner Friendly. Hardier and more tolerant of dry air and temporary dry soil than Maidenhair or Boston Ferns.

Sunlight Diet

Bright, indirect light or dappled shade. Protect from direct afternoon sun, which will instantly bleach and shrivel the glossy green fronds.

Thirst Level

Moderate. Keep the potting mix damp but not soggy. Avoid watering directly into the center of the rosette (the nest), which can cause rot.

Rooting Terrain

Very free-draining, organic mix. A blend of 60% premium indoor soil, 20% peat moss, and 20% orchid bark or perlite replication.

Atmosphere

Enjoys warm temperatures and moderate-to-high humidity. Thrives in Sydney and Brisbane. In dry winter rooms, use a humidity tray.

Multiplication

Sowing spores. It is slow and complex to divide, so purchasing small potted specimens is standard practice.

Form & Vibe

Architectural, tropical, and soft. Large rosettes of glossy wavy leaves that create a dramatic focal point on tabletops.

Perfect Placement

Warm bathrooms, shaded patios, verandas, or bright tables out of direct drafts from air conditioners and heaters.

Toxicity Watch
Pets: Safe
Kids: Safe

Safe:Completely non-toxic to cats, dogs, and children. A safe and native choice for any Australian family home.
